Park Attendant Services Robert W. Craig Campground Jennings Randolph Lake (#2)
The U.S. Army Corps of Engineers seeks a live-in park attendant contractor for the Robert W. Craig Memorial Campground at the Jennings Randolph Lake Project in Garrett County, Maryland and Mineral County, West Virginia. The contractor will manage all aspects of the campground reservation program, including registering campers, collecting fees, and performing daily campground checks. The performance period is specified in an updated Performance Work Statement dated 07 April 2025. The project area receives approximately 100,000 annual visitors, with peak use between Memorial and Labor Day.
